Benllech attractions for couples

Benllech, nestled on the stunning Anglesey coast, offers a delightful blend of sandy beaches, scenic walks, and family-friendly activities. The beach itself is a highlight, with its golden sands stretching for miles, perfect for building sandcastles or enjoying a leisurely swim in the calm waters. For those keen on exploring nature, the nearby Red Wharf Bay provides breathtaking coastal walks, where you can spot diverse wildlife and enjoy picturesque views across the bay. History enthusiasts will appreciate a visit to the ancient burial chamber of Bryn Celli Ddu, an intriguing site that dates back over 5,000 years. Families will also love the nearby Anglesey Sea Zoo, where kids can marvel at local marine life, and perhaps even engage in some hands-on activities. When is the best time of year for a romantic getaway to Benllech?
If you're hoping to get lost in the rain on your romantic getaway, take a look at these details about year-round temperatures in Benllech: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Benllech is 1064 mm.
